Minutes ago, we brought you the updated BMW X1 and now Mercedes GL Class has also been revealed by AutoForum.cz. The second generation GL Class adopts Mercedes’s new design language seen on the SL and SLK-Class. The front is aggressive, almost poses like its an AMG model.

So what has changed on the outside?

Quite a lot actually –

  • A new headlamp design similar to one on the new SL
  • A bulging hood
  • Redesigned grill with oodles of chrome
  • LED running lamps above large air intakes
  • The new GL has an upward sweeping shoulder line
  • The new wraparound taillights and LED fog lights complete the visual updates

What has changed on the inside?

  • The new GL is based on an extended ML-Class platform. The Mercedes boffins have managed to squeezed 10 mm of more headroom.
  • The cabin carries over from the ML-Class and has leather seats, wood trim and metallic accents.
  • Best quality materials and more up-to-date tech should be at your disposal

What about the engine options?

Though no official confirmation is available, here is what our friends from Autoforum.cz predict:

  • 3.0L diesel engine with to 265 or 306 horses.
  • 4.6L V8 petrol mill generating around 400 to 450 horsepower.

When does it come to India?

The new GL-Class will be assembled next year at Mercedes Benz India’s Chakan plant but the German automaker could sell imported units of the GL-Class months before assembly starts. Sales of the GL-Class could begin in early 2013.
